Keepsakes

Keepsakes are small, sentimental objects kept for the memories they evoke. They serve as tangible reminders of people, places, or events that hold personal significance. These items often represent a connection to the past, offering comfort, nostalgia, and a way to cherish relationships or experiences. They can be anything from photographs and jewelry to letters and small trinkets, acting as touchstones to the emotions and stories they encapsulate. The value of a keepsake lies not in its monetary worth, but in its ability to connect us to meaningful moments and individuals.
